Stacy Wade, 53, of Middle River, Maryland, passed away November 12, 2020, at Stella Maris in Lutherville, Maryland after a long fight against cancer. He was born on January 28, 1967, in Piggott, Arkansas, to Paul and Mary Wade. Stacy was united in marriage to Laura (Wellman) Wade on March 5, 2011. He is preceded in death by his father, Paul Wade, Sr.; mother-in-law, Charlene Cook; maternal grandparents, Cassius Osgood and Lorene Rowe; paternal grandparents, Mutt and Lily Wade. Stacy was the Quarterback for the Piggott Mohawks during his high school years. He worked in construction in his early years but has worked as a Heavy Equipment Operator for Republic Services for the last six years. He loved fishing and playing the drums. He also loved BBQing and playing with his grandkids He was always the life of the party.
